El-Rufai berates open cattle grazing, says ranching only way forward Published Governor Nasir el-Rufai of Kaduna State, in Adamawa State on a visit Tuesday, said the way out of persistent herder-farmer clashes is ranching. The Kaduna State Governor, who spoke to newsmen shortly after a call on his host, Governor Ahmadu Fintiri at the Government House in Yola, insisted that open grazing of cattle is no longer realistic. Daily Post Nigeria Published The Deputy Governor’s home is also located along the Brighter Road. The incident, it was gathered, happened at around 11:00am, when men of the state Urban Development Board stormed the area to carry out the exercise of removal of illegal structures in the area. Unhappy with the move, the youths and traders turned their frustration and annoyance on the residence of the deputy governor standing on the same lane.
